What you'll do
- You'll support the Senior Account Manager with all the day-to-day account management and project management.
- Helping to be the glue that holds everything together, making sure that all the tasks, deliverables and milestones are achieved by the team.
- You'll be another point of contact for the client, building a rapport with them and understanding their needs.
- You'll be able to ask the right questions to get clarity on the project scope, timelines and deliverables.
- You'll also support the onboarding process with new clients, liaising with their procurement and marketing teams.
- And alongside this, supporting the new biz team from a purely project management and logistics support perspective.

What you'll need
- You understand brand and advertising and have worked on previous integrated advertising campaigns (film, TVC, print, digital and experiential).
- You'll be comfortable working with unconventional ideas and have experience in supporting an Account Manager/ Senior Account Manager.
- You're good at project management because you're organised.
- You'll have a proven track record of supporting advertising projects from start to finish, ensuring tasks, deliverables and milestones are achieved as projects go from client briefing, strategy, creative and production.
- You'll have worked at a medium - large ad agency where you've gained experience in both account exec’ing and project exec’ing.
- You’ll also (hopefully) have an interest in the outdoor sports world, as that’s our bread and butter. Anything from running, cycling, skiing. Whatever fun stuff you can do outdoors.

About the company
Our clients are household names and scrappy wannabes on the way up. But they all have one thing in common, they’re all Underdogs with something to say.
We’re an independent advertising agency with a reputation for making distinctive advertising for outdoor Sports Underdog clients. We bring fun, irreverence and a touch of chutzpah into our work and culture. We are a small and friendly team.
